Counselor's Corner
Just Breathe!
Middle school can be stressful both socially and academically. Almost everyone who has been stressed, angry, or anxious has had someone tell them, “Relax and take a few deep breaths.” That’s because it works. One reason is “mindfulness.” Focusing on breathing can quiet your mind and help you gain control of your thoughts. Deep breathing can also help students perform better on tests.
One simple breathing exercise is called Diaphragmatic Breathing. Here’s how it works:
- Sit or stand in a relaxed position with your hands on your stomach
- Feel your hands move outward while you inhale through your nose for 4 seconds
- Hold in the breath for two seconds
- Feel your hands move inward and you exhale through pursed lips for 8 seconds
- Repeat 5 to 10 times
